What situation is the Compliance Ready Organizational Resilience for?
Innovation teams move fast, but when auditors or regulators ask for evidence, the narrative often collapses into last-minute patchwork. Practitioners know the drill: rework, reconciliation, and reactive justification. The cost isn’t just time, it’s credibility.
